The Facebook page for Creative Assembly’s Shogun 2: Total War has posted up five new screenshots depicting naval activities in the latest entry in the Total War series.
Actually, four of them show either boats or people on the deck of said boats, while one shows a fashionable bowman leading a larger squad of archers. They may be firing arrows at boats though, we just can’t be sure. As we’ve already learned naval combat will be a feature of Shogun 2, with designer James Russell stating that it’ll be “focusing a lot on boarding systems and stone-scissors-paper interplay between different ship types.”
It’s not entirely clear whether these are in-game images. They look a little too polished for that, so if they really are from the in-game engine it’s possible some post-processing ‘treatment’ has been applied.
